How to troubleshoot Noisy Pipes - Water Hammer
Water hammer is a loud banging noise in pipes caused by water stopping suddenly. This guide covers fixing the issue.
Step-by-Step Fix
- Identify which pipes are making the banging noise.
- Secure any loose pipes with pipe clips.
- Check the water pressure - if above 4 bar, install a pressure reducing valve.
- Install water hammer arrestors on washing machines and dishwashers.
- Drain the system to remove trapped air.

Frequently Asked Questions
What causes water hammer?
Water moving at high speed being suddenly stopped by a tap or valve closing.
